Gerald Raymond House, 76, of Vader, WA, passed away Tuesday, October 29, 2013, at Providence Centralia Hospital in Centralia, WA. Arrangements were with Funeral Alternatives of Lacey, WA. A private family service will be held at a later date, with interment at Slayton Memorial Gardens in Slayton, MN. Gerald Raymond House was born on February 22, 1937, in Westfield, IA. He was the son of Raymond and Violet (Skogsberg) House. He received his education in Fulda, MN, and graduated from Fulda High School in 1955. Gerald enlisted in the Minnesota National Guard in 1960 and served his country for 3 years, after which he received an honorable discharge. Gerald was a Mason and a proud member of the Murray Lodge #199 for over 50 years. He followed the path of the Scottish Rite and went on to become a Shriner. He was also a member of the ElRiad Shrine in Sioux Falls, SD. On December 6, 1958, Gerald was united in marriage to Linda Veenhuis. This marriage was blessed with two children, Scott and Shari. Gerald later married Sharon Easterday in 1990. In addition to farming, Gerald held employment as a commercial and private airplane pilot. His career path led him to residences in Sioux Falls, SD, Oklahoma City, OK, Sherman Oaks, CA; and Tacoma, WA. After retiring from flying Gerald worked briefly as a licensed realtor and a long haul truck driver. Gerald’s love of farming took him back to Minnesota every fall to harvest corn and beans. His favorite pastime was restoring his antique John Deere tractors and Lindeman crawler. He also enjoyed tending to his small orchard of honey crisp apple trees. Gerald especially enjoyed the time he spent with his children and grandchildren. Gerald is survived by his children, Scott House and his wife, Carrie, of Puyallup, WA, and Shari Zieman and her husband, Dale, of Hutchinson MN; grandchildren Bradley Zieman and Jessica Zieman of Hutchinson, MN, Valerie House of Puyallup, WA, and step-granddaughter Carolyn Watson of Puyallup, WA; his sister, Shirley Johnson and her husband, Earl, of Slayton, MN, cousins, and nephews. Gerald was preceded in death by his parents, Raymond & Violet House, and an infant son Joel R House.
